Bradford Family Tree

Timothy and Regan Bradford's children are:

1. Jared, married Megan, their son is Jason Bradford, (m. Haley) male parent of Cole, Elizabeth, Joshua, and Hunter

2. Sarah, passed away. Her son is Trevor who married Zoe, and fathered, Jonathan, Sebastian, Mathew, and Jessica.

3. Ethan, married Mary, and their children are, Duncan (m. Necie), Danny (m. Jodi), Lucifer (m. Rebecca), Kenzie (m. Roger), Arik, Garrett, Reese (m. Kasey, kid Mikey, two sets of twin boys), Darrin (m. Marybeth, triplet girls), and Aidan (g. Melanie, one son)

iv. Mark married Jessie, sons are Reed (thousand. Joey) and Matt.
5. Ryan, married Amanda, their children are, Eric and Theo.
6. Shane, married Caylee, son is Devin (one thousand. Charlie) children are Abbi and Dustin.
7. Thomas, married Heather, girl is Nikki.

The James Family
(Cousins to the Bradfords)

Raised by Wes and Beth Bradford:
David James, divorced, raised children by himself, Rory (k. Connor, 2 children), Bryce, Johnny, Craig, Brian, and Sean.

New York Times Bestselling writer, R.L. Mathewson was built-in in Massachusetts. She's known for her humor, quick wit and ability to write relatable characters. She currently has several paranormal and contemporary romance series published including the Neighbor from Hell series.

Growing upward, R.50. Mathewson was a painfully shy bookworm. After high school she attended college, worked equally a bellhop, fast food cook, and a museum worker until she decided to take an EMT course. Working as an EMT helped her get over her shyness as well equally left her with some fond memories and some rather agonizing ones that from time to time show upward in one of her books.

Today, R.L. Mathewson is the unmarried female parent of ii children that keep her on her toes. She has a bit of a romance novel addiction as well as a major hot chocolate habit and on a perfect day, she combines the two.
